At the end of the first 12 month growing period verticut the Bermuda turf to remove <br />all thatch. Continue to verticut Bermuda turf on a one time per year basis. Coordinate <br />dates for this work with the City. <br />10. Aeriate Bermuda turf with a turf aerator each 6 months (2 times per year). <br />Coordinate dates for this work with the City. <br />11. Drag, grade, and smooth the clay infield, including base paths two times per week <br />(days to be determine by city). <br />For striping use Plus 5 athletic marker. City will advise contractor of additional field <br />preparation, as needed, with a minimum of six hours notice from city. <br />Tamp mound area two times per week and fill in existing holes with available clay <br />(supplied by Bidder) and firm the area with a hand tamp. <br />12. Stripe ballfield as directed by City. <br />13. Empty and dispose of contents of all trash containers on a daily basis. Contractor is <br />responsible for disposal of all trash in accord with all Federal, State, and local <br />regulations. <br />V. PAYMENT <br />1. The payment process begins when the contractor notifies the Director of Community <br />Services or designee of work <br />2. The contractor is to notify the Director of Community Services or designee's office by <br />9:00 a.m. of the following work day regarding work areas completed. Following such <br />notice, the City shall inspect the maintenance area indicated within 24 hours. If the <br />contractor's performance does not show completion of maintenance items previously <br />described, the City shall request, and require corrective action to be taken at no charge <br />to the City. <br />3. Payment for work shall be authorized upon evidence of completion, and will occur on <br />a monthly basis. Payment will be made by the 12th of the month for work completed e <br />previous month. <br />BIDDERS NAME: Luke Facarazzo <br />COMPANY NAME: Lukes' Landscaping, Inc . <br />
